Songjeong is a lovely beach Situated in close proximity to Haeundae. You can accessibility it by taking the Beach Prepare or Sky Capsule (+20min stroll together the Coastline) or by a brief taxi or bus experience. Songjeong will be the surfer paradise in Busan. There are various surf outlets together the beach and is among the most popular locations for surfing in Korea.

On foot or by practice, it is kind of straightforward to explore Taejongdae Park, that is usually crowded on weekends. Head over to its observatory initially. Then keep on that has a pay a visit to to its popular lighthouse, which 부산고구려 presents Charming sights of your coastal shoreline (also to the Japanese islands of Tsushima on a clear day), as well as a rocky beach below. The little Taejongsa Buddhist temple completes this nice walk of about 2 hours.

Songdo Skywalk would be the 3rd skywalk in Busan. This a person is the longest as it extends from Songdo Beach and overhanging on top of Turtle Island. It is a very interesting sight in Busan and the most effective tips on how to appreciate the beauty of the sea and its all-natural surroundings.
